The public elementary schools with the highest share of Hispanic students in Harlan County, Kentucky

This ranking covers the public elementary schools with the highest share of Hispanic students in Harlan County, Kentucky, drawn from 9 qualifying public elementary schools. Green Hills Elementary School leads the list at 9.5%, against a median of 1.6% across the ranked schools.
